Lawson Kashiwazaki Nishikicho Shop is located in Kashiwazaki, Japan on 2-21 Nishikicho. Lawson Kashiwazaki Nishikicho Shop is rated 3 out of 5 in the category convenience store in Japan.
Service options
In-store pick-up
In-store shopping
Accessibility
Wheelchair-accessible car park